Observation: Earth From The Moon


caption: The color photograph of Earthrise - taken by Apollo 8 astronaut, William A. Anders. December 24,1968. Although the photograph is usually mounted with the moon below the earth, this is how Anders saw it. Photo taken from www.abc.net.au/science/moon/earthrise.htm

Hear now my observation from the circle. At least an observation from last summer. I realized that the Apollo astronauts were on the moon long enough to see Earthrise but not long enough to see the waxing and waning of the planet. I realized that the earth does this but it looks different than you might suspect. When the moon is waxing, the earth is waning. The Full Moon sees a New Earth. The New Moon sees a Full Earth. Now at the time of the waxing moon, it is the time of the waning earth.

On this blog you are witnessing a first. The first pagan to keep track of moon/earth phases. Our moon is proportionately speaking, the largest in the solar system. We are not living on a planet that happens to have a moon as much as we are living on half of a double planet. This is why I started to list moon/earth phases in the esbat notes.
